With the  great sunshine we’ve had all week I thought I would start bikini week! I’m going to feature a new bikini everyday this week, tell you who should wear it and who should not and most importantly where to get it!!

Victoria Secret has such great bikinis this year! With so many to choose from its hard to say one is the best but I’ll try.

bikini.jpg

This bikini is great, it’s the new line at VS, Becca® by Rebecca Virtue, it has neutral colouring but the embroidery adds some style and flare. The halter neck is great for a larger chest and the bottoms tie at the side which allows those with bigger to hips to avoid the sides digging in and creating unflattering overhang. Top retails for $60 and the bottoms for $48.

 b-2.jpg

There’s also a top with more coverage for $78. This is good for those who want to hide your tummy area.

b3.jpg

And if your thighs and butt are the trouble areas then you can also get the cover up skirt for $58. Which means this bikini can be worn by anyone! Just mix and match the pieces that will work with your body-shape.

LouLou Magazine’s Trend Watch

March 18, 2008 at 5:12 am (fashion) (, , , , )

Canada’s fashion magazine Lou Louhas listed some trends to watch for this spring. runways exploded with bright, citrus hues as the trend in women’s fashions switches gears. Goodbye, gloomy grey and Hello, tropical sunshine! If you see this season’s revival of colour as a breath of fresh air, then you’ll love what the big names like Jil Sander, Michael Kors, Yves St Laurent, Lanvin and Alberta Ferretti are doing with it. Look for stripes or big slabs of yellow, orange and green. 

babyphat.jpg

This look is all about not looking severe, so let your hair down and go for sun-drenched exuberance. Accessorize freely with strappy sandals, a chunky chain or big sunglasses and one of the season’s It bags.

joefresh_coat.jpg

Want a bargain? Check out Joe Fashion (at superstore) for some great colourful pieces, the coat above is a steal at $29!. Tip: The quality wont be there, I wouldn’t recommend staple pieces but for fun summer trends they have great pieces to add a pop of colour to your wardrobe.
